If you think you've found an exciting prospective property to buy, you'll need to perform some kind of inspection first. If you are going to be investing a large sum your hard earned money in a single transaction, you owe it to you to ultimately do a thorough job of inspecting the item. While you may eventually hire an outside professional to do a home inspection, it certainly is good to do an initial inspection on your own. Hiring outside help will always have a price, so it's best to weed out any houses with obvious red flags on your own. By researching the major warning flags, it can save you yourself the problem of buying a home that will need extensive repairs to become worthwhile when you attempt to flip it on the market. Being educated on the state of properties for sale may also give you negotiating room should you choose want to buy a house that requires major work. There's plenty to consider when touring prospective properties.

Whenever you walk around any property, you want to immediately focus in on the condition from the foundation. Look for any visible cracks or leaks. Does anything appear to be lopsided? If you're sensing immediate problems, you will need to consider the baseboards and ceilings. Should there be a basement, check up on the current condition. If there are problems with the foundation of the home, there's a pretty good possibility there's a leak which has spread to the basement. If you notice any moisture or water damage and mold in the basement, you are going to have a significant project to deal with should you purchase hat house. Acquire the best round the basement further, you have to verify the house can properly drain itself. Somewhere there must be a sump pump that allows the foundation to empty in case of a significant storm or perhaps a large quantities of melting snow. A good sump pump can reduce the chance of flooding, saving you from the major financial headache. When the house has some kind of crawl space, find out when there is any moisture. Should there be some dampness in this region, you are able to guarantee that there's some issue with how the water is drained. Check the walls and ceilings for any obvious watermarks too. Water that seeps into the foundation can be the catalyst for mold, and if you have mold in your home, it's certainly going to cost you a bundle to have it removed.
